Rachel's Scholarship

Today at assembly Mr Holstein came to give out a Peerswick scholarship to Rachel W, a Year 8. The scholarship is for two new Year 9 entrances, a boy and a girl. Rachel has been rewarded 1,000 dollars to spend at her leisure and will be going to Riccarton High.

Art Extension News

The Art Extension group have started to work with crayoning. In the last lesson, the whole group went out to the wildscape to study and draw bushes and trees.

Unfortunately, with the tight schedule that the Year 7s and 8s have, Art Extension may have to be moved to a more suitable time for students.

iPADS IN THE LIBRARY!

The school has purchased 2 new iPads to use in the library.They have Q-Book, which is for reading in a variety of languages including Spanish, Japanese, Chinese, Te reo Maori, French and many more. Some of the books on there now are well known favourites such as Hairy Maclary& Wonky Donkey. If you have a personal favourite you can ask Mrs Junovich to download it for you. These are avaliable in the library at morning tea and lunch. These are brand new so when you use them please make sure you treat them with care, as they are very expensive!

Maths Extension

ON THE STAIRCASE
How many different ways are there to walk up 10 stairs if you can walk up 1 or 2 stairs at a time?

Hint: Use the Fibonacci Sequence.
